By bringing together its family of leading artists and the latest communications technology, GMN.com provides exclusive live performances, video interviews, lectures, recitals and a range of value-added content. ------------------------------ Date: Tue, 25 Jan 2000 08:59:13 -0800 (PST) From: Brian Clayton Subject: RE: Alloy: Dolby on KFOG this morning Well, it was a pretty good session with Thomas--he demonstrated Beatnik once again, this time emphasizing the Groovegram aspect of Beatnik. He asked folks to mail in a Groovegram, and I quickly fired off my one version of Science 1999, but they didn't get time to play anything they solicited, oh well. A negative point for them playing "She Blinded Me With Science" when I know those guys have a deeper appreciation of TMDR's music and could have reached for something else, but it's understandable given that they were about to do a quick demo of the Science remix immediately thereafter. But a big positive point to Peter Finch, the news guy, who lamented the fact that there haven't been any new Thomas CDs in a while and that he missed his music! Thomas' reply was that he "thinks [he] will get back into it," but that right now the exciting place to be is on the Web.
